Subject: Loyalty overhaul — quick heads-up

Hi all,

The Emberline Rewards revamp is moving faster than expected. Finance has modelled the new points structure and the redemption liability actually drops about 9% under the tiered scheme. Marta's team will circulate full figures Friday. Before the wider announcement, please keep the following strictly within this group.

board note of baweg-bawig: Project Tamath slips by six weeks because of the audit delay.

### Step 2: Enable the Flagbridge rollout framework

This step moves services off hardcoded toggles and onto Flagbridge. Each service registers its flags at boot, and rollout percentages are evaluated server-side, so no client redeploy is needed for ramp changes. Stale flags older than ninety days get flagged for cleanup automatically. Complete Step 1 (registry bootstrap) first, or registration calls will fail silently. Once the registry is reachable, apply the following configuration to each service.

deployment values, taweg-bajop:
[fenvan]
port = 5672
team = holmir
host = fenvan.orvexio.example
region = lower-1
access_code = ac_b98bc6
timeout_ms = 1500

Handover note: failed exports from the Tidemark reporting pipeline now retry automatically with exponential backoff, capped at five attempts. Exports that exhaust retries land in the dead-letter bucket and trigger a Pageglass alert. New team members should review the runbook before touching retry settings. Escalations about stuck exports go to the contact below.

account owner for bawip-tahag: Raleth Quenok